Re: [PATCH] Disable BROKEN MSM_IOMMU

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



On Feb 24 2015 or thereabouts, Nicolas Chauvet wrote:
> MSM_IOMMU doesn't play nice in multi-platform kernel
> This is causing probe issue as it tries to register unconditionally
> 
> Specially experienced on tegra_drm where IOMMU support was enabled
> for tegra30 and later since 3.19. It has prevented the fallback
> to non-iommu in the tegra20 case.
> 
> This need additionals "workaround" patches for EXYNOS, OMAP and Rockchip.
> v2 for thoses patches are reported at:
> http://lists.linuxfoundation.org/pipermail/iommu/2015-February/012226.html
> 
> This config change and thoses additionals patches would need
> to be backported down to 3.19 fedora kernels


fwiw, there was a patch upstream to mark MSM_IOMMU as depends on
BROKEN.. not sure if that would be sufficient

(either way, I don't really mind, the current upstream msm-iommu is not
actually used by any driver, at least not until I get time to rename
qcom-iommu and rework it to fit the one-true-iommu-bindings..)
